In fruit flies, eye color is a sex-linked trait. Red is dominant to white.
ozzi

Answer:

The correct answers are:

1 a. X^RX^r - red eye color female

b. X^RX^R - red eye color female

c. X^RY - red eye color male

d. X^rY - white eye color male

e. X^rX^r - white eye color female

(2nd part can also be answered by above)

Explanation:

It is given that the eye color is a sex-linked character where Red eye color is dominant over white eye color in fruit flies. Sex-linked characters are the character that is a similar inheritance pattern except in the case of the male as there is a Y chromosome that does not carry the gene for the eye color trait so the trait will depend on the allele present on a single  X chromosome in males.

On the basis of this, the sex and color of eyes will be:

a. X^RX^r - red eye color female - Dominant character will mask the recessive white color and two copies of X which means female.

b. X^RX^R - red eye color female - both copies are dominant so red-eye color will be expressed and two copies of the X chromosome that means female

c. X^RY - red eye color male - One X and one Y chromosome that means male and only dominant allele present so red eye color.

d. X^rY - white eye color male - Only allele that is present is recessive with one Y chromosome that means male with white eye color.

e. X^rX^r - white eye color female - two X chromosomes with recessive allele which means white eye color female.
